The phrase "all perils" is correct and usable in written English.
It is typically used in the context of insurance policies to refer to coverage that protects against all types of risks or damages.
Example: "The homeowner's insurance policy includes coverage for all perils, ensuring that the property is protected against any unforeseen events."
Alternatives: "all risks" or "comprehensive coverage".
